The Czechoslovakia Olympic football team was the national under-23 football team of Czechoslovakia from 1922 to 1993, before the country split into the Czech Republic and Slovakia (For information about the national teams of the two countries, see the articles Czech Republic national under-23 football team and Slovakia national under-23 football team.)

Olympic Record

Since 1992 the Olympic roster may consist out of under-23 year old players, plus three over the age players.[1]

Host Nation(s) - Year Result GP W D* L GS GA
  1924 Round 1 3 1 1 1 6 4
  1928 Did not qualify - - - - - -
  1932 No Olympic football tournament - - - - - -
  1936 Did not qualify - - - - - -
  1948 Did not qualify - - - - - -
  1952 Did not qualify - - - - - -
  1956 Did not qualify - - - - - -
  1960 Did not qualify - - - - - -
  1964 Runner-Up 6 5 0 1 19 5
  1968 Round 1 3 1 1 1 10 3
  1972 Did not qualify - - - - - -
  1976 Did not qualify - - - - - -
  1980 Champion 6 4 2 0 10 1
  1984 Withdrew - - - - - -
  1988 Did not qualify - - - - - -
  1992 Did not qualify - - - - - -
Total 4/16 18 11 4 3 45 13
